What is an ETF?

An ETF, or “exchange-traded fund,” is a type of investment fund that trades on a stock exchange. ETFs are baskets of securities that track an underlying index, such as the S&P 500 or the Dow Jones Industrial Average. 

ETFs can be bought and sold throughout the day like stocks, and they provide investors with a diversified, low-cost way to invest in a wide variety of assets, including stocks, bonds, and commodities.

How do ETFs work?

An ETF is created when a fund manager buys stocks, bonds, or other assets that match the underlying index of the ETF. The manager then creates new shares of the ETF and sells them to investors.

The price of an ETF is determined by the market, and it can rise and fall throughout the day just like individual stocks. ETFs can be bought and sold through a broker just like any other stock.

What is the difference between a Vanguard fund and a Vanguard ETF?

A Vanguard fund is a mutual fund, while a Vanguard ETF is an exchange-traded fund. Vanguard funds are bought and sold directly from Vanguard, while Vanguard ETFs are bought and sold on the stock exchange. Vanguard funds are typically more expensive than Vanguard ETFs. Vanguard funds have higher minimum investment requirements than Vanguard ETFs. Vanguard funds typically have a longer history than Vanguard ETFs. Vanguard ETFs are more tax-efficient than Vanguard mutual funds.

What is Vanguard’s most popular ETF?

What is Vanguard’s most popular ETF?

The Vanguard S&P 500 Index ETF (VOO) is Vanguard’s most popular ETF. As of September 30, 2018, VOO had over $101 billion in assets under management (AUM).

VOO is an index fund that tracks the S&P 500 Index. The S&P 500 Index is a stock market index that includes 500 of the largest American companies.

VOO is a low-cost fund. The expense ratio for VOO is 0.04%. This means that for every $10,000 you invest in VOO, Vanguard will charge you $4 per year.

VOO is a passively managed fund. This means that the fund’s managers do not attempt to beat the market. They simply track the S&P 500 Index.
